Язык определения функций (например, openAPI?) - PullRequest
0 голосов
/ 27 апреля 2018

Мне нужно определить большой набор функций, которые позже будут использоваться на нескольких языках программирования. Существует ли какое-либо стандартное описание интерфейса, не зависящее от языка программирования, для таких функций, как OpenAPI для REST API?

Мне нужно определить

  • имя
  • описание
  • входные параметры, включая типы и / или схемы
  • вывод, включая тип и / или схему
  • возможно: категоризация функций

В конце концов, я хотел бы создать из него удобочитаемую документацию, как вы можете это сделать и с OpenAPI.

...